Output 2263a7fba794aeb5b1a3baecd4566fb167b4593ba1d3233d9f953f7102130036:20

value
2607268
script pubkey
OP_0 OP_PUSHBYTES_20 4d3fceb010d6410329c63f9d7351ee2d57f0e416
address
bc1qf5luavqs6eqsx2wx87whx50w94tlpeqkx0r4zq
transaction
2263a7fba794aeb5b1a3baecd4566fb167b4593ba1d3233d9f953f7102130036
spent
true